thank u both, i folowed your advices. i changed the basedn to *basedn = "dc=example,dc=com"*
i can* successfully* perform a * ldapsearch -x -b "dc=example,dc=com" uid=bernard*
I beg to differ, you can successfully connect to your ldap server and perform a search.
But you got this back:
# search result search: 2 result: 0 Success
# numResponses: 1
Means that ldap search didn't find anything.
I suspect your BaseDN is wrong, plus you probably need a proxy user to login with as well. As you may not have enough rights to search.
You should solve those issues first, before you start digging into your FR config.
